Transcribed Image Text:The Backflushers Manufacturing Corp. uses a Raw and In Process Inventory account and expenses all conversion costs to the cost of goods sold account. At the end of each month, all inventories are counted, their conversion cost components are estimated and inventory account balances are adjusted accordingly. Raw material cost is backflushed from RIP to finished goods. The following information is for the month of May: Raw and In Process inventory account, May 1, including P500 of conversion P 5,000 cost Raw materials received during May (50% down, balance in four installments) 100,000 Raw and In Process inventory account, May 31, including P650 of estimated conversion cost 5,250
